India’s Future Supply Chain Solutions has opened a new integrated apparels / general merchandise distribution centre at Burdwan district in West Bengal.

Spread over 260,000ft², the new distribution centre is capable of serving all Big Bazaar and FBB stores located in the states of West Bengal, Orissa and Bihar, as well as other North Eastern states.

With its standardised distribution processes, full automation and integrated IT solutions, the centre will ensure a better level of service to customers across the country.

Future Group CEO Kishore Biyani said: “The new distribution centre at Burdwan will enable us to reduce complexity, increase productivity and offer better services to our customers in the Eastern region.

“Our aim has always been to come up with better processes and technology that enables us to operate seamlessly.”

The centre is strategically located at the junction of Old GT road and Kolkata-Delhi Highway.

Future Supply is responsible for managing the supply chain and enables its customers to focus on their core activities.

The company provides services such as storage, retail store replenishment, inventory planning and control, vendor management, quality assurance, barcoding and packaging solutions.

It has 120 branches across India and 46 warehouses, including six logistic parks covering six million square feet.
